ATLANTA, Ga. (Atlanta News First) - More than 2,000 steps. Each one a tribute.

Firefighters, first responders, and community members are gathering at Truist Park over the weekend to honor the 343 firefighters who lost their lives in the September 11, 2001 terrorist attacks.

The annual Patriot Day 9/11 Memorial Stair Climb , hosted by the Atlanta Braves Foundation, Terry Farrell Firefighters Fund, and Georgia Fraternal Order of Leatherheads Society, brings participants together to climb more than 2,000 steps — symbolizing the 110 flights of stairs that New York City firefighters ascended inside the Twin Towers.

Climbers also received a lanyard with the name and photo of someone who died on 9/11, carrying it with them throughout the climb as a personal act of remembrance.
